89405-80-1

89405-80-1 structure
89405-80-1 structure

Name 1-(4-Chloro-phenyl)-3-[2-(4-chloro-phenyl)-4-oxo-thiazolidin-3-yl]-thiourea
Molecular Formula C16H13Cl2N3OS2
Molecular Weight 398.33000
Exact Mass 396.98800
PSA 101.76000
LogP 4.87080